Arthur J Almeida, 75, passed away Saturday, February 23, 2013 at Crouse Hospital. Born in Syracuse, and a life resident of Lakeland. Arthur graduated from Solvay High School in 1956 and Syracuse University in 1977. He retired from General Electric after 37 years of service in 1993. After retirement, he worked for Sensis Corporation for 17 years and retired in 2010. Arthur was a hardworking, warm, generous and kind man who loved his wife, three children, three granddaughters and four granddogs. Arthur loved to spend his free time working on or cruising in his mustangs. he looked forward to his yearly vacations with his family. Arthur also loved sports and was a loyal Syracuse University sports fan. Surviving are his wife of 54 years, Patricia Wiacek; son, Richard (Sharon) Almeida; daughters, Roxanne Almeida and Karen (Derek) Hmiel and three granddaughters, Tiffany, Brianna, and Alyssa Almeida and granddogs, Buca, Tekki, Gunner & Colby.
